Cover Feature: Dara Santana

Dara Santana’s work with water is revolutionizing coffee. In this issue’s cover feature, we meet this remarkable engineer whose entire career course was altered when she discovered the beauty of specialty coffee. She now devotes her life to teaching others about how water affects everything from processing to brewing.
‘From Oat to Art: Pouring Beautiful Lattes with Plant Milk’

While customers’ demand for alternative milks continues to grow, options for foam-worthy plant milks have increased recently as well, as writer Josh Rank discovers.
‘Thrills + Chills: Riding the Supply, Demands, and Disruptions of Today’s C-Market’

C-market volatility has made headlines and set recent price records. Ana Mallozi looks at what the C-market is, what drives price fluctuations, and what it means for retailers in the June + July 2025 issue.
‘One on One: Jenna Gotthelf’
From her home in New York, Jenna Gotthelf of Counter Culture Coffee has traveled the country educating people about coffee at different classes in different cities, rolling up miles like a veteran basketball player. We learn all about her in this interview.
Pull-Out Preventative Maintenance Poster

Thanks to the generous support of Urnex, every copy of the June + July 2025 issue includes a pull-out preventative maintenance poster to help you keep your café equipment in great shape. Compiled by longtime equipment service tech Jon Ferguson, the poster provides a quick reference tool for keeping your cleaning and maintenance on schedule.
